Designing a Comfortable and Welcoming Game Night Space
Hosting a successful game night starts with transforming any standard dining room or living area into an inviting, functional hub. The key is balance: you need bright, glare-free lighting to read tiny card text, comfortable seating that supports hours of play, and a clear surface where everyone can reach the board.
Many hosts make the mistake of focusing solely on the game selection, leaving guests to struggle with dim overhead fixtures or stiff dining chairs. By intentionally planning the physical environment, you eliminate physical fatigue and eye strain before they start. A well-designed layout keeps the focus on strategy and socializing rather than physical discomfort.

Smart Ways to Organize Pieces for Fast Setup and Cleanup
The dread of a lengthy setup or teardown process can quickly kill the momentum of a game night. To keep the energy high, ditch the chaotic mass of factory plastic bags inside your game boxes. Utilizing small, stackable silicone pinch cups or clear plastic jewelry organizers during play keeps tokens sorted and prevents the frustration of searching through a massive pile for a single resource.
Before guests arrive, pre-sort player-specific starting pieces into individual bags or small tins. When it is time to play, you can simply hand each person their designated color pack rather than sorting pieces on the fly. This simple preparation cuts setup time in half and gets everyone playing immediately.
During cleanup, involve your guests by turning it into a collaborative effort. Assigning simple tasks—like sorting cards by back pattern or grouping resources—speeds up the packing process. Secure the finished boxes with cross bands, ensuring they are ready to be pulled off the shelf for the next gathering without a messy surprise.
Streamlining Snacks to Keep Your Game Pieces Clean
Mixing greasy fingers with delicate cardboard components is a recipe for ruined games. While snacks are vital for keeping energy up, strategic menu planning is key to preserving your collection. Opt for dry, bite-sized foods like pretzels, grapes, or nuts instead of powdery chips, buttery popcorn, or sticky wings.
Keep food and drinks off the primary playing surface entirely by utilizing small nesting side tables. This setup drastically reduces the risk of accidental drink spills that could warp expensive game boards. Providing plenty of cloth napkins or wet wipes nearby ensures guests can clean their hands easily before touching game pieces.
